Flatbed Applicator Market was valued at USD 2.5 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 4.5 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 8% from 2024 to 2030.
The Flatbed Applicator Market is categorized into several key applications, with a notable segmentation focusing on commercial, residential, and others. The demand for flatbed applicators has risen across various industries due to their versatility and efficiency in precise application of coatings, adhesives, and other materials. This market includes industries such as printing, textiles, packaging, and even automotive, where the demand for flatbed applicators is growing steadily. The flatbed applicator is designed to provide an even and controlled spread of materials, which makes it an ideal solution for applications that require high precision. With the technology's ability to cater to diverse industrial needs, the flatbed applicator remains a crucial component in enhancing production efficiency.

1. What is a flatbed applicator used for?
A flatbed applicator is used for evenly applying coatings, adhesives, and other materials onto substrates, ensuring precision and consistency in the application process.
2. How does a flatbed applicator work?
A flatbed applicator uses a flat surface to hold substrates while a roller or nozzle applies the material evenly across the surface for uniform coating.
3. What industries use flatbed applicators?
Flatbed applicators are used in industries like packaging, textiles, printing, automotive, healthcare, aerospace, and agriculture for precise material applications.
